Output 06691b9473942e59d52eeed147cc7de91eaf52c9b7c50ea2034126e3c11ec637:1

value
18345152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e512164dd0708d705fb34a36b19226a6f969c1b OP_EQUAL
address
MHxTkaEAzENw5NstULUsxJ2dgWMCmQC97Z
transaction
06691b9473942e59d52eeed147cc7de91eaf52c9b7c50ea2034126e3c11ec637
spent
true